DFM & Material Grades
Silicone hardness (Shore A) is matched to the application. Food molds use FDA or LFGB grades, medical projects need biocompatible silicone, and industrial parts may use stronger blends. Some buyers refer to “custom silicon molds,” but the material is the same—clarify grade when placing orders.
Item | FDA (U.S. Food and Drug Administration) | LFGB (German Food, Articles of Daily Use and Feed Code) |
Applicable Regions | United States and countries that recognize FDA (North America, Latin America, parts of Asia) | Germany, European Union, and other markets requiring LFGB |
Testing Focus | Checks for harmful substances in materials: heavy metals (e.g., lead), volatile organic compounds (VOC), overall migration tests | Stricter requirements: in addition to heavy metals and VOC, also includes odor and taste migration tests |
Testing Difficulty | Less strict, high pass rate, short cycle (7–10 days) | More strict, lower pass rate, longer cycle (10–15 days) |
Cost | Lower testing cost, commonly used for products exported to the U.S. | Higher cost, but boosts trust in the EU market |
Typical Applications | Silicone baking molds, silicone cup lids, silicone ice trays for the U.S. market | High-end food molds, baby silicone tableware, silicone nipples, premium baking molds in Europe |
Customer Awareness | Widely recognized by U.S. and international brands, suitable for most OEM orders | Mandatory requirement for European clients, especially in Germany and France |

How to Order Custom Silicone Molds Step by Step
B2B projects follow a structured process. Here is how to order custom silicone molds effectively:
-
Inquiry – Share drawings, dimensions, quantities, and use cases.
-
DFM Review – Engineers suggest adjustments for clean release and longer life.
-
Quotation – Pricing depends on size, cavities, hardness, and branding.
-
Sampling – Most suppliers deliver samples in 5–7 days.
-
Approval – Test with your material (resin, wax, chocolate, soap).
-
Production – Scale to wholesale volumes with quality control at each stage.
-
Delivery – Export packing and global shipping, including FBA/DDP options.

Compliance & Quality Control
Working with a professional silicone mold making company ensures compliance and trust. Food molds require FDA or LFGB certificates; cosmetic packaging may need REACH or ROHS testing. Manufacturers provide documentation, material traceability, and QC reports. This transparency builds confidence for long-term cooperation.
